Comprehending the Problem: Causes of Broken Car Keys
Broken car keys can occur from numerous circumstances. Comprehending the underlying causes can assist motorists avoid future problems:
Wear and Tear: Over time, frequent use can use down the key, making it more vulnerable to breaking.Accidental Damage: Dropping the key or utilizing excessive force can lead to physical damage.Key Misalignment: If the key does not properly fit in the lock, it may break during turn.Deterioration of Key Material: Keys made from softer metals or plastic products can deteriorate quicker, causing damage.Ignition Issues: Problems with the ignition might require a motorist to use additional pressure, resulting in a broken key.Actions to Take When You Encounter a Broken Car Key

The cost of dealing with a broken car key can differ based on several aspects:
Service TypeEstimated Cost RangeMobile Locksmith₤ 60 - ₤ 150Key Replacement at Dealers₤ 100 - ₤ 250Key Cutting Services₤ 10 - ₤ 30DIY Repair Kits₤ 5 - ₤ 15
Costs can vary based upon the make and model of the vehicle, as well as the regional company's pricing strategy.
